It is variant, the DJI Agras T25 caters to scaled-down or medium-sized farming operations, offering a compact and more maneuverable choice devoid of sacrificing the technological advancements located in its more substantial counterpart. With a ability to carry here up to twenty kg for spraying and 35 kg for spreading, it is very well-suited for operations that do not need the large-responsibility abilities from the T50 but nonetheless reap the benefits of high precision and performance.
The DJI Agras T50 comes with a payload capacity of as much as forty kg for spraying and 50 kg for spreading, which makes it perfect for considerable operations. Its Highly developed dual atomization spray process can deal with a formidable stream rate of as much as 24 liters for every minute, ensuring that large regions are included promptly and effectively.
